About Waypointer Font

Waypointer is a font that can be used to indicate direction or emphasis in documents, signage, or websites. It is easy to use because its size matches the standard cap height of most fonts.

The arrows are accessed with the standard keyboard keys. Make your own arrow of any length with the 1 to 9 keys. Use uppercase (A to Z) and lowercase (a to z) for pre-made arrows that point right, left, up, or down.

Those who use OpenType will find useful features, such as stylistic sets for changing arrow directions in 360 degree angles and stylistic alternates for quick changes between pointing right and left.

It has a few extras such as a map pin, anchor, and lightning bolt. These are included and accessed with the comma, period, and zero keys.
